10 Work From Home Office Table Ideas With Laptop

Home work isn't disappearing anytime soon, and having a distinct, well-organized workspace can change your level of focus and comfort. No matter if you have a whole room or just a plain corner, your office desk setup must be both efficient and an extension of your style.

Following are 10 smart and stunning home office table designs around laptop use — for any room and mood.


---

1. Minimalist Wood Desk Setup
A clean wooden table, a comfortable chair, and your computer — that's all you need for a clean, minimalist appearance. Add one indoor plant or a white lamp to soften the appearance.

Best For: Focused work with no distractions.


---

2. Foldable Wall-Mounted Desk
If space is limited, utilize a foldable table that can attach to the wall. When it is not being used, you can fold it up and win back the space. Pair it with a lean chair and laptop for a well-working nook.

Best For: Studio apartments or bungalows.


---

3. Boho Corner Setup
Bring a bohemian vibe with a whitewashed wood or rattan computer desk, plush chair, and accessories like woven baskets, pampas grass, and macramé wall decor. Your laptop is snug in this bohemian heaven.

Best For: Pinterest fans and artists.


---

4. Variable Height Adjustable Standing Desk
A contemporary height-adjustable desk allows you to switch between standing and sitting. Position your laptop on a stand and sit properly.

Good For: People with back problems or prolonged working hours.


---

5. L-Shaped Compact Desk
For multitaskers, an L-shaped desk is heaven. It offers space for your laptop on one side and notebooks or another monitor on the other.

Pro Tip: Keep it clean and tidy using a cable organizer.


---

6. Glass Top Table with Chrome Legs
This produces a sleek and modern office ambiance. Glass-top office desks don't absorb light and make the space feel larger. Complete the look with a leather office chair and chrome desk lamp to maintain the ambiance.

Best For: Modern and stylish home offices.


---

7. Rustic Farmhouse Desk
Consider a wooden desk in a reclaimed condition, black metal frames, and minimal accessories with a touch of green. Put your laptop in the middle and add an old accessory or a ceramic coffee mug for pens.

Feels Like: Warmth, comfort, and creativity.


---

8. IKEA-Inspired Budget Desk Setup
Choose a low-cost desk hack like IKEA's classic white tabletop on trestle legs. Then incorporate a laptop stand, wireless keyboard, and pale accessories for a light, crisp look.

Best For: Students or budget-conscious employees.


---

9. Floating Desk in a Window Nook
Turn your window sill into a floating desk. Lean a thin wooden plank against the wall and put your laptop on it. Have sunlight while you work — and maybe a cup of coffee too.

Best For: Writers and remote workers who prefer sunlight.


---

10. Dual Monitor Laptop Desk Setup
For multi-screen users, choose a desk that will accommodate a dual monitor + laptop setup. Install a monitor arm and place your laptop on a riser to get eye-level ergonomics.

Needs: Cable trays and an ergonomic chair for extended periods.
